Going Green
Everything involved in producing new fixtures impacts the environment adversely. With refinishing, those adverse effects are significantly reduced for individuals, hotels, and apartments. Did you know that more materials go to landfills during a remodeling project than an entire new construction project? The National Association of Home Builders (NAHB) estimates that close to 32 million tons of waste per year are sent to landfills from home remodeling projects. The garbage coming from construction and demolition debris accounting for 20% of all landfill waste, with 43% of that contributed from residential construction and renovation projects.
With all the concerns about global warming, overfull landfills, conservation and greenhouse gases, we believe that refinishing makes a substantial contribution in reducing the future impact on our environment.
